New Delhi: BJP member and Advocate Ashwini Upadhyay has filed a Public Interest Litigation in the Supreme Court to implement Law Commission Report no.267 on Hate Speech.
The commission's 267 report suggested amendments to the Indian Penal Code,1860 and the Code of Criminal procedure,1973 by adding new provisions on 'Prohibiting incitement to hatred' following section 153B IPC and 'causing fear, alarm or provocation of violence in certain cases' following section 505 IPC, and accordingly amending the First Schedule of the CrPc.
Upadhyay through his PIL said that representation of people's act, appealing to people on the grounds of religion, race, caste, community or language etc and promotions of feelings of enmity between different classes constitute a corrupt practice. But this corrupt practice can be questioned only through election petition in case of winning candidates and there is no provision of questioning the lost candidates even by-election petition.
